mariadb

zabbix,yum安装记录

萝らか妹 提交于 2020-01-08 13:38:55
首先我已经讲yum源设置为阿里源 [root@localhost ~]# yum install nginx php php-devel php-mysql php-fpm 已加载插件: fastestmirror, langpacks Loading mirror speeds from cached hostfile * base: mirrors.aliyun.com * extras: mirrors.163.com * updates: mirrors.cn99.com 1. 问题: 没有可用软件包 nginx 。 解决: [root@localhost ~]# sudo rpm -Uvh http://nginx.org/packages/centos/7/noarch/RPMS/nginx-release-centos-7-0.el7.ngx.noarch.rpm sudo yum install -y nginx [root@localhost ~]# systemctl start mariadb 2. 问题 :Failed to start mariadb.service: Unit not found 解决: 1.[root@localhost ~]# yum install -y mariadb 2.[root@localhost ~]# yum

Mariadb安装,Apache源码包安装

五迷三道 提交于 2020-01-07 14:17:00
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> MariaDB介绍 MariaDB数据库管理系统是MySQL的一个分支,主要由开源社区在维护,采用GPL授权许可 MariaDB的目的是完全兼容MySQL,包括API和命令行,使之能轻松成为MySQL的代替品。在存储引擎方面,使用XtraDB(英语:XtraDB)来代替MySQL的InnoDB。 MariaDB由MySQL的创始人Michael Widenius(英语:Michael Widenius)主导开发,他早前曾以10亿美元的价格,将自己创建的公司MySQL AB卖给了SUN,此后,随着SUN被甲骨文收购,MySQL的所有权也落入Oracle的手中。MariaDB名称来自Michael Widenius的女儿Maria的名字。 MariaDB安装 先进入/usr/local/src 目录 下载 wget https://downloads.mariadb.org/interstitial/mariadb-10.2.6/bintar-linux-glibc_214-x86_64/mariadb-10.2.6-linux-glibc_214-x86_64.tar.gz,我在使用这个命令下载不成功,提示错误,于是去官网下载到本地pc然后上传到/usr/local/src目录下的。 解压 tar zxvf

安装mariadb、安装Apache

纵然是瞬间 提交于 2020-01-07 14:15:52
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> 安装mariadb 安装mariadb的步骤与安装mysql的一样 下载二进制源码包 再用tar 解压,创建/data/mariadb目录和用户 初始化 编译启动脚本 启动 安装Apache Apache是软件基金会的名字,软件的名字叫httpd。 安装httpd,要同时安装apr 和apr-util 。 下载二进制源码包 使用tar解压 安装apr 安装apr-util 安装httpd 编译 使用make命令 安装 make install 来源: oschina 链接: https://my.oschina.net/u/3867258/blog/1919932

MariaDB重装后原Data文件中的数据恢复

≡放荡痞女 提交于 2020-01-07 14:06:37
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> MariaDB在程序出现异常,或者无法启动时,可尝试重装应用,那么重装后,原来的数据没备份怎么办呢?这个时候需要用到Data文件夹下面的文件。 第一步,把旧的Data文件夹拷贝到桌面或者任意一个位置,只要不影响重装即可,然后安装好MariaDB; 第二步,如果数据库启动了,需要手动停止掉。接着拷贝旧的Data文件夹中需要恢复的数据库,比如我要恢复“yunqi”这个数据库,将其拷贝到新的Data文件夹,然后把旧的Data文件夹中的aria_log.00000001、aria_log_control、ib_logfile0、ib_logfile1、ibdata1这五个文件拷贝到新的Data文件夹下,覆盖掉。 第三步,启动数据库,然后用Heidisql(MariaDB安装后自动安装的MySql工具)连接数据库,发现“yunqi”数据库恢复好了。 来源: oschina 链接: https://my.oschina.net/u/1866080/blog/730318

How to make a FULLTEXT search with ORDER BY fast?

自作多情 提交于 2020-01-07 11:13:51
问题 I'm trying to get a simple FULLTEXT match to be faster when using order by on another column on a table with over 100 million rows. Is it possible to make a FULLTEXT with an order by on another indexed column fast? SQL Fiddle below with schema and explains of all queries: http://sqlfiddle.com/#!9/ed646c/1 What I have so far is denormalization and a join but this requires a separate table and I would rather not have another table if not necessary. SQL Fiddle below (denormalized query at the

MySQL与MariaDB安装(三)

被刻印的时光 ゝ 提交于 2020-01-07 07:46:47
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> 第一部分 MariaDB 安装 (Mac) 总体步骤 : 1. xcode-select --install 下载最新xcode 2. 配置并检测Homebrew; 3. 下载MariaDB: brew install mariadb 4. 启动数据库下载器 mysql_install_db(前提: 切换至安装目录下) 5. 启动数据库服务: mysql.server start 6. mysql_secure_installation: 对基本的一些信息的配置 7. 连接数据库: mysql -u root -p Mac 现在 还没有 MariaDB 的官方安装工具 。不过你可以用 Homebrew 来 下载和安装所需的包(其中包括所需的库)。 第二部分 MariaDB 安装 重要 的几个步骤 #下载 $ brew install mariadb . #链接数据库 To connect: mysql -uroot #如果想登陆启动数据库执行该语句 To have launchd start mariadb now and restart at login: brew services start mariadb #如果不想自启动执行该语句 Or, if you don't want/need a

Window下同一台服务器部署多个MariaDB(Mysql)、服务方式启动简要配置

烂漫一生 提交于 2020-01-07 06:41:24
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> 版本:MariaDB 10 环境:D盘下,放2个 MariaDB解压版,分别是 D:\ MariaDB、 D:\ MariaDBA 1、进入 MariaDB、 MariaDBA,复制my-XXX.ini (不同的文件对应不同的硬件配置),改名为 my.ini 2、 文本编辑器打开 D:\ MariaDBA的 my.ini ,修改把2个涉及端口的地方,避免与 MariaDB的冲突 3、注册服务,进入 D:\ MariaDB\bin,命令运行“mysqld .exe --install MariaDB10” , 进入 D:\ MariaDBA\bin,命令运行“mysqld .exe --install MariaDB10A” ,这时候Window的服务中会出现2这个服务,可以进行启动(mysqld.exe -remove MariaDB10、 mysqld.exe -remove MariaDB10A可以去掉服务 ) 附常用命令 修改ROOT密码( bin目录下 ):mysqladmin .exe -u root password "123456" 导出数据库( bin目录下 ) :mysqldump.exe -u root -p db_test > d:\ db_test. sql 导入数据库(登入数据库后)

MariaDB10自动化安装部署

半城伤御伤魂 提交于 2020-01-07 04:47:06
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> MariaDB10自动化安装部署 去MariaDB官网下载MariaDB本文用的是MariaDB 10.1.16 https://downloads.mariadb.org 选择二进制版本,下载到/root目录下 mariadb-10.1.16-linux-x86_64.tar.gz 开始安装 [root @HE3 ~]# cat mariadb_auto_install.sh [root @HE3 ~]# cat mariadb_auto_install.sh [root @HE3 ~]# cat mariadb_auto_install.sh ###### 二进制自动安装数据库脚本root密码MANAGER将脚本和安装包放在/root目录即可############### ######数据库目录/usr/local/mysql############ ######数据目录/data/mysql############ ######日志目录/log/mysql############ ######端口号默认3306其余参数按需自行修改############ ################## #author:rrhelei@126.com# ################## #!/bin/bash

Check-mk installation. Failed dependencies (Mariadb, Python-reportlab, libgsf)

╄→гoц情女王★ 提交于 2020-01-06 23:45:06
问题 I have problem with installation check_mk on amazon-ec2. I have already installed nagios core successfully and I try now install check_mk plugin by rpm: rpm -ivh check-mk-raw-1.2.8p17-el7-40.x86_64.rpm Rpm stop and return list of needed dependencies for installation. Most of them I installed successfully but I have problem with rest of it. error: Failed dependencies: mariadb-server is needed by check-mk-raw-1.2.8p17-el7-40.x86_64 python-reportlab is needed by check-mk-raw-1.2.8p17-el7-40.x86

Mariadb-10.2.25 多实例

女生的网名这么多〃 提交于 2020-01-06 22:07:26
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> Mariadb-10.2.25 多实例 定义目录 mkdir -p /mysql/{3306,3307,3308}/{bin,data,etc,log,pid,socket} 生成数据库文件 /app/mysql/scripts/mysql_install_db --datadir=/mysql/3306/data --user mysql /app/mysql/scripts/mysql_install_db --datadir=/mysql/3307/data --user mysql /app/mysql/scripts/mysql_install_db --datadir=/mysql/3308/data --user mysql 权限设置 chmod -R mysq.mysql /mysql 配置文件 cp mariadb-10.2.25/support-files/my-huge.cnf /mysql/3306/etc/my.cnf vim /mysql/3306/etc/my.cnf [mysqld] datadir = /mysql/3306/data port = 3306 socket = /mysql/3306/socket/mysql.sock [client] port = 3306